Dyno Jet kit help/questions

Anyone else using Dyno Jet stage 1 jet kit and find that it runs way to rich. I bought it and did the stage 1 which by the manual says stock air box and filter (I’m using drop in UNI filter) and stock or slip on exhaust (running stock mufflers at the moment) Eclip on the needles 4 slots down from the top, 2.5 turns out on the Air fuel screw, drilled slides with supplied drill bit, and used suggested main jet from the Dyno jet instructions. This Dyno jet kit uses stock pilot jet. So far I can tell it’s running rich you can smell how rich it is through the exhaust.

Prior to this I have all stock carb components and had 1mm shims under the stock needles, 2.5 turns out on the air fuel screws. Ran great.

But this Dyno jet kit has ruined how this bike runs. Just want know know if anyone has experience with the Dyno Jet kits and what you thought about it. Valves were adjusted, Carbs were sync’d, set float height wet and set to the base of the carb body prior to installing jet kit.
